Millennium Management LLC cut its holdings in shares of Petco Health and Wellness Company, Inc. (NASDAQ:WOOF - Free Report) by 5.3%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 6,028,544 shares of the company's stock after selling 340,444 shares during the period. Millennium Management LLC owned about 1.92% of Petco Health and Wellness worth $22,969,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Petco Health and Wellness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 WOOF opened at $3.86 on Wednesday. The company has a current ratio of 0.84, a quick ratio of 0.22 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.40. The stock has a 50 day simple moving average of $3.02 and a 200-day simple moving average of $3.50. The company has a market cap of $1.22 billion, a PE ratio of -9.65 and a beta of 1.74. Petco Health and Wellness Company, Inc. has a 12-month low of $2.23 and a 12-month high of $6.29.

Analysts Set New Price Targets

A number of brokerages have issued reports on WOOF. Citigroup cut their target price on shares of Petco Health and Wellness from $5.00 to $2.75 and set a "neutral" rating on the stock in a report on Tuesday, March 18th. Wedbush cut their target price on shares of Petco Health and Wellness from $6.00 to $4.00 and set an "outperform" r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, March 27th. The Goldman Sachs Group raised their target price on shares of Petco Health and Wellness from $4.00 to $4.48 and gave the stock a "buy" rating in a report on Thursday, March 27th. Royal Bank of Canada cut their target price on shares of Petco Health and Wellness from $6.00 to $4.00 and set an "outperform" r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, March 27th. Finally, Robert W. Baird cut their target price on shares of Petco Health and Wellness from $5.00 to $3.50 and set a "neutral" r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, March 27th. Five anal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and five have given a bu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, Petco Health and Wellness presently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us target price of $4.11.

Petco Health and Wellness Profile

(Free Report)

Petco Health and Wellness Company, Inc, operates as a health and wellness company, focuses on enhancing the lives of pets, pet parents, and its Petco partners in the United States, Mexico, and Puerto Rico. The company provides veterinary care, grooming, training, tele-health, and Vital Care and pet health insurance services, as well as veterinary services through Vetco mobile clinics.
